| Orlando's Convention and Visitor Bureau just released a new interactive map for the Orlando tourist and convention areas. I actually checked it out, as I will be heading there again in January. It looks like a great tool to help plan a trip, allowing the user to customize exactly what areas and features you would like to have visible including lodging, attractions, restaurants, spas and shopping. Plus you can print out your customized points of interest. Kudos to the Orlando CVB!
